Transaction ebd41d6056567858663b3b5b19a2a91d387800a1b11462c72f4e29d42081ba71
1 Input
1 Output
-
ebd41d6056567858663b3b5b19a2a91d387800a1b11462c72f4e29d42081ba71:0
- value
- 732220
- script pubkey
- OP_0 OP_PUSHBYTES_20 5dfb5ff7c9f56ed368659b6dff3a9e4492442060
- address
- bc1qtha4la7f74hdx6r9ndkl7w57gjfyggrq2a8kxf